This new system we're on has a lot of great features. One of them allows us to create a new field that is required for members to fill out during signup / registration. We can then display this field in their "postbit" (the area to the left of every post with the avatar, location, etc.).

For example, on my printer forum we require that new members enter in the model of printer they own, and display that below their Avatar on every post.

This does 2 things:
  1. It helps reduce the amount of spam since robots don't know how to use the field and other country spammers struggle with the question
  2. It helps members know more about their fellow members who are posting
So, we're thinking of adding a required field here too, but we need your help on brainstorming what that field should be. What basic information should we require of every member that signs up that would be helpful and/or fun to know?
